## FabriKit 4.0 — Changed Defaults

FabriKit now generates opaque surrogate keys instead of sequential integers, and all synthetic PII fields default to masked output. Seeded randomness is disabled unless explicitly enabled, preventing reproducible dumps leaking into fixtures. Reviewers should confirm downstream assertions tolerate these changes. The effective defaults after upgrade are as follows.

settings of fafog-haduf:
ZORIX_PIN=4648
ZORIX_METRICS_HOST=metrics.zorix.paliqsys.corp
ZORIX_LOG_LEVEL=info
ZORIX_TENANT=druix

### Retrying failed exports

ExportRelay retries failed export jobs with exponential backoff, capped at six attempts over two hours. Maintainers should not re-enqueue jobs manually unless the failure code is TRANSIENT_STORE; other codes indicate schema drift and need investigation first. Manual re-enqueues go through the internal retry endpoint, which authenticates with the service key provided below.

app token of bawep-hafog = kto7_vwrmnlx

Subject: Handover — Fledgeline firmware channel DB

Hi Marit,

Taking off Friday, so here's the short version. The firmware update channel writes rollout manifests and device check-in state to the channel database; nightly vacuum runs at 02:00 and the staged-rollout job is chatty but harmless. Watch the check-in table growth after big pushes. Future maintainers: everything the channel service needs lives behind the connection string below.

primary connection of yagep-kahip = redis://giliel_svc:zYiKsLL2PLpfPL@db-348f.xolmarsys.corp:5432/fenwyn

Step 4 of the Broomvale migration: moving the deploy-status bot from Lattermill to the new Pingrose runtime. Please verify the bot no longer polls the legacy release feed; it must subscribe to the Pingrose event stream instead, or duplicate notifications will appear in every channel. Confirm the retry queue was drained before the cut, and that the old webhook route returns 410. Once those checks pass, apply the runtime settings below verbatim — any deviation should block the review. The required configuration follows.

deployment values, yadug-bawif:
[framir]
team = pelox
access_code = ac_a38ab2
owner = tamion.julael
host = framir.tolvaqlabs.test
port = 11211
peer = tammir.zemvargrid.local
salt = 2215ef03
pin = 1541